Alibaba Cloud Linux(原 Alibaba Cloud Linux 2/3,现统一为 Alibaba Cloud Linux,最新稳定版为 Alibaba Cloud Linux 4)与 Anolis OS 都是阿里云主导研发的开源国产 Linux 发行版,同源且目标一致(服务云上服务器场景),但二者在定位、演进路径、发布形态和适用场景上存在关键区别。以下是主要对比:
| 维度 | Alibaba Cloud Linux(ACL) | Anolis OS |
|---|---|---|
| 定位与角色 | ✅ 阿里云官方认证的“云操作系统”,作为阿里云 ECS 实例的默认/首选系统镜像,深度集成云平台(如弹性网卡、NVMe SSD、eRDMA、安全启动等)。 ✅ 面向生产环境直接部署,提供长期支持(LTS)、商业级 SLA 和阿里云技术支持。 |
🌐 社区驱动的开源发行版(OpenAnolis 社区项目),目标是构建自主可控、中立开放的通用 Linux 发行版生态。 ✅ 定位为“中国版 CentOS/RHEL 替代方案”,强调社区共建、多厂商参与(华为、腾讯、Intel、中科曙光等均加入)和跨云/本地化兼容性。 |
| 技术同源性 | ⚙️ 基于 Anolis OS 源码构建(尤其 ACL 3/4 与 Anolis OS 8/23 高度一致);ACL 使用 Anolis 的内核、用户态组件(如 glibc、systemd)及补丁集,但会增加阿里云专有优化和驱动(如 aliyun-kernel、aliyun-init、cloud-guest-utils 等)。 |
⚙️ 是上游基础:Anolis OS 是 ACL 的上游参考实现和社区主干。ACL 的部分改进(如内核热补丁、eBPF 工具链增强)会反哺 Anolis 社区。 |
| 内核与核心组件 | 🔧 默认搭载 定制化 aliyun-kernel:• 深度优化云场景(容器密度、网络延迟、I/O 调度) • 内置热补丁(kpatch)、eBPF 增强、cgroup v2 优先支持 • 提供 kernel-livepatch 服务(无需重启修复高危漏洞) |
🔧 提供 标准 anolis-kernel(基于 RHEL/CentOS 兼容内核),更侧重稳定性与兼容性;也支持可选的 aliyun-kernel(通过额外仓库安装),但非默认。 |
| 生命周期与支持 | 📅 严格 LTS 策略: • ACL 3:2021–2026(5年) • ACL 4:2023–2028(5年) ✅ 由阿里云全栈保障(内核、安全更新、CVE 响应 <24h,关键漏洞 4h 内热补丁) |
📅 社区 LTS 版本(如 Anolis OS 23)提供 5 年支持,但依赖社区协作交付;安全更新节奏与响应时效性不承诺商业 SLA,需用户自行评估风险。 |
| 分发与获取方式 | ☁️ 主要通过 阿里云控制台/ECS 镜像市场直接选用(预装优化工具、自动注册云监控、一键配置 VPC 网络) ✅ 支持一键部署、快照迁移、镜像共享等云原生能力 |
💾 提供 ISO 镜像下载(官网 openanolis.org),支持物理机、VMware、KVM、主流公有云(含阿里云)手动部署;无云平台深度绑定,更适配混合云/私有云场景。 |
| 生态与兼容性 | ✅ 100% 兼容 RHEL/CentOS 生态(.rpm 包、YUM/DNF 仓库) ⚠️ 部分阿里云专属工具(如 aliyun-cli、ecs-utils)仅在 ACL 中预装并深度集成 |
✅ 同样 100% 兼容 RHEL/CentOS 生态(二进制兼容) ✅ 更强调跨厂商兼容性测试(已通过 OpenStack、Kubernetes、主流数据库认证),避免云厂商锁定。 |
| 典型适用场景 | • 阿里云 ECS 上运行核心业务(Web/数据库/中间件/容器) • 追求开箱即用、最小运维成本、最高云平台集成度 • 需要阿里云官方技术支持与故障兜底 |
• 多云/混合云环境统一操作系统基线 • 自建私有云或信创环境(符合国产化替代要求) • 开源项目/ISV 基于中立发行版构建解决方案 |
✅ 总结一句话:
Alibaba Cloud Linux 是 Anolis OS 在阿里云环境中的“企业级发行版”——它继承 Anolis 的开源基因与兼容性,但叠加了阿里云深度优化、商业支持和云原生集成能力;而 Anolis OS 是面向更广泛生态的“社区标准版”,强调开放、中立与自主可控。
📌 选型建议:
- 若您全部使用阿里云 ECS → 优先选 Alibaba Cloud Linux(性能更好、支持更强、运维更省心);
- 若您需要跨云部署、私有化交付、或参与国产化生态共建 → 推荐 Anolis OS(避免厂商锁定,符合信创目录要求,社区活跃)。
💡 补充:自 2023 年起,阿里云已将 ACL 4 与 Anolis OS 23 的内核、用户态版本对齐(均基于 Linux 6.1 + RHEL 9 兼容栈),二者差异正逐步收敛于“云优化”与“通用性”的策略选择,而非技术鸿沟。
如需具体版本对比表(如 ACL 4 vs Anolis OS 23 的内核参数、默认服务、安全特性),我可为您进一步整理。
云知道CLOUD